The Ocupational and Organisational Psychology MSc programme is taught by a core team of three Chartered Occupational Psychologists, who are active in the fields of consultancy, research and international collaborations. We also offer additional input, provided by in-house specialists in the fields of Coaching Psychology, Counselling & Psychotherapy, Positive Psychology, Vocational Psychology and Educational Psychology. We have excellent links with the profession and currently have seven internships each year to offer our students, along with a prize for the best dissertation. Four of these internships are in the NHS, working on special projects for the Head of Occupational Health for a large NHS Trust, and each lasts for three months. The fifth is a six-week internship with a global HR Services Group operating across the world and covering ?the whole of the employment lifecycle. This organisation also offers a £250 prize for the best dissertation each year. In addition to these opportunities, we also have internships with a training consultancy and a small occupational psychology practice. Alongside these opportunities, we bring our students together with the profession in other ways. All assessed coursework takes place in organisational settings, including one project with the Occupational Psychology Team of a major international bank. Requirements:
Minimum 2:2 with honours (or equivalent) Bachelor of Arts (BA) or Bachelor of Science (BSc) , in Psychology degree with Graduate Basis for Chartered Membership accredited by the British Psychological Society. Students whose first degree does not confer Graduate Basis for Chartered Membership will be considered for the MSc Business Psychology. Please note you would usually be expected to have at least a Grade C in English and Maths GCSE or equivalent. Most programmes also accept Key Skills Level 2 Application of Number and Communication as equivalent to GCSE Maths and English.
International Requirements:
Overall IELTS 7.0 with a minimum of 6.5 in Writing, Speaking, Reading and Listening (or recognised equivalent).
